Meatball from long-extinct mammoth created by food firm

March 28, 2023 from the The Guardian:

"A mammoth meatball has been created by a cultivated meat company, resurrecting the flesh of the long-extinct animals.

"The project aims to demonstrate the potential of meat grown from cells, without the slaughter of animals, and to highlight the link between large-scale livestock production and the destruction of wildlife and the climate crisis.

The mammoth meatball was produced by Vow, an Australian company, which is taking a different approach to cultured meat.

"There are scores of companies working on replacements for conventional meat, such as chicken, pork and beef. But Vow is aiming to mix and match cells from unconventional species to create new kinds of meat.

"The company has already investigated the potential of more than 50 species, including alpaca, buffalo, crocodile, kangaroo, peacocks and different types of fish.

"The first cultivated meat to be sold to diners will be Japanese quail, which the company expects will be in restaurants in Singapore this year.

"In 2018, another company used DNA from an extinct animal to create gummy bears made from gelatine from a mastodon, another elephant-like animal.

"Vow worked with Prof Ernst Wolvetang, at the Australian Institute for Bioengineering at the University of Queensland, to create the mammoth muscle protein. His team took the DNA sequence for mammoth myoglobin, a key muscle protein in giving meat its flavour, and filled in the few gaps using elephant DNA.

"This sequence was placed in myoblast stem cells from a sheep, which replicated to grow to the 20bn cells subsequently used by the company to grow the mammoth meat.

"No one has yet tasted the mammoth meatball. 'We haven’t seen this protein for thousands of years,' said Wolvetang. 'So we have no idea how our immune system would react when we eat it. But if we did it again, we could certainly do it in a way that would make it more palatable to regulatory bodies'"”
